Our utility water pumps client needed to reduce their CO2 emissions and fuel costs by running their site on battery power for as long as possible, without compromising on performance.
Our team assessed the client’s on-site power demands before recommending an optimised solution that was appropriate for the application. Alongside a 60kVA generator, we proposed our Hussh Pod 45/90 – 90kWh of useable energy storage with 45kVA three-phase inverters.
The integration of the Hussh Pod into the client’s power set up reduced generator run time over the hire period by 843 hours, saving the client £10,796 in fuel costs and reducing CO2 emissions by 30,987kg.
Over the period, the site ran 84% on battery power leaving only 16% on the generator.
As part of the Power Saving Solutions service, reporting was sent to the client to demonstrate performance, savings and return on investment.
